First rule of medicine: Do no harm. When a pet presents with ear infections, the vet isn't going to rush to radical surgery right off the bat. The correct course of action is to treat conservatively, and increase the severity of treatment over time. The owners and previous vet did just that, until reaching a point where treatment was beyond the normal vet's ability to provide. As mentioned in the video, this kind of surgery will leave the dog largely deaf in that ear and could potentially damage the facial nerve. That is a treatment of last resort and not something any good vet is going to prescribe for chronic ear infections without ruling out every other possible treatment.

They don't touch the flap of the ear or any other part with this surgery. It's strictly to remove the interior ear canal. Then they sew it up and leave a little hole down level with the horizontal ear canal so it can drain easily.
